Music Director Shyamal Mitra

Shyamal Mitra was a celebrated music director and playback singer from India, born on January 14, 1929, in Naihati, Calcutta. He made significant contributions to the Bengali music industry and is remembered for his baritone voice and musical versatility. His career began with a struggle, finding his breakthrough in 1949 as a playback singer and never looking back after his early success with the song “Smriti Tumi Bedonar”. Mitra’s talent spanned across singing and composing, leaving a lasting legacy with his work in over a hundred Bengali films and directing music in more than fifty of them. Some of his famous songs include “Tomar Samadhi Phule Phule Dhaka”, “Gaane Bhubon Bhoriye Debe”, and “Amar Sopne Dekha Rajkonyya”.
